This work studies the novel solar water heater using natural black rocks as the absorption material. The objective of this study is to compare the thermal performance of solar water heater between using black rocks and black copper pipes. Both options were tested at the same parameters such as 0.8 m2 collector area, angle tilted 19° and 30 litters of water tank volume. The experimental results showed that the maximum mean temperatures of solar water heater of absorption type using natural black rock system and black copper pipes system were 54.3 °C and 50.7 °C, respectively. In addition, the efficiencies of the water heater of absorption type using natural black rock system and black copper pipes system were 44.6% and 33.5%, respectively. Therefore, the water heater of absorption type using natural black rock system is another option used in the household sector to reduce the energy consumption of the country.
